Understanding Chimney Overheating Risks

Chimney overheating occurs when excessive heat builds up within the flue system, creating dangerous conditions that can lead to structural damage and fire hazards. The primary culprit behind most chimney overheating issues is improper ventilation combined with accumulated debris or creosote deposits that restrict airflow.

Common Causes of Overheating

Several factors contribute to dangerous temperature spikes in chimney systems:

  • Creosote buildup from incomplete wood combustion

  • Blocked or partially obstructed flues

  • Improper chimney sizing for your heating appliance

  • Damaged or deteriorated chimney liner

  • Excessive fuel loading in wood stoves

Warning Signs to Watch For

Early detection of overheating prevents catastrophic damage:

  • Discolored or cracked chimney exterior

  • White staining (efflorescence) on chimney walls

  • Damaged roof materials around the chimney base

  • Unusual odors during operation

  • Visible smoke entering living spaces

Essential Pre-Use Safety Inspection

Before lighting any fire, conducting a thorough chimney inspection ensures safe operation and identifies potential hazards. This critical step prevents most overheating incidents and protects your investment in heating equipment.

Visual Exterior Assessment

Start your inspection by examining the chimney's external condition:

  • Check for cracks, loose mortar, or damaged bricks

  • Inspect the chimney cap and spark arrestor

  • Verify proper clearance from roof materials

  • Look for rust stains or white mineral deposits

Interior Flue Examination

Use a flashlight to inspect accessible portions of the flue:

  • Check for creosote buildup or debris accumulation

  • Look for damaged or missing mortar joints

  • Verify the damper opens and closes properly

  • Inspect for animal nests or foreign objects

Creosote Management and Prevention

Creosote buildup represents the most significant threat to chimney safety, as this highly flammable substance can ignite and cause devastating chimney fires. Understanding how to minimize creosote formation and remove existing deposits is essential for preventing overheating incidents.

Types of Creosote Deposits

Different burning conditions create varying creosote consistencies:

  • Stage 1: Flaky, easy-to-remove deposits from proper burning

  • Stage 2: Tar-like substance requiring professional removal

  • Stage 3: Hard, glazed coating that's extremely dangerous

Prevention Strategies

Proper burning techniques significantly reduce creosote formation:

  • Burn only seasoned hardwood with moisture content below 20%

  • Maintain hot, complete combustion fires

  • Avoid smoldering or overnight burns

  • Ensure adequate air supply to the fire

Proper Ventilation and Airflow

Maintaining adequate airflow prevents dangerous heat accumulation and ensures complete combustion. Poor ventilation creates conditions that promote creosote buildup and increase the risk of carbon monoxide exposure.

Damper Operation Guidelines

Proper damper management controls airflow and prevents overheating:

  • Open damper fully before lighting fires

  • Adjust gradually to maintain proper draft

  • Never close damper with active embers present

  • Check damper functionality during regular maintenance

Addressing Flue Blockage

Flue blockage severely restricts airflow and creates dangerous conditions:

  • Remove debris, leaves, or animal nests promptly

  • Install chimney caps to prevent future blockages

  • Schedule professional cleaning for stubborn obstructions

  • Monitor for ice dam formation in winter months

Wood Stove Safety Protocols

Wood stove problems often stem from improper operation or inadequate maintenance, leading to overheating and potential fire hazards. Following manufacturer guidelines and implementing proper safety protocols ensures efficient, safe operation.

Fuel Selection and Loading

Choosing appropriate fuel prevents excessive heat generation:

  • Use only dry, seasoned hardwood species

  • Avoid burning treated lumber, cardboard, or trash

  • Load fuel gradually to prevent temperature spikes

  • Monitor stove thermometer to maintain optimal temperatures

Clearance Requirements

Proper clearances prevent heat transfer to combustible materials:

  • Maintain minimum distances from walls and furniture

  • Install heat shields where required by manufacturer

  • Ensure adequate floor protection beneath the stove

  • Keep combustible materials away from hot surfaces

Regular Maintenance Schedule

Consistent chimney maintenance prevents most overheating issues and extends the life of your heating system. Establishing a routine maintenance schedule ensures early detection of problems before they become dangerous.

Monthly Inspection Tasks

Regular monthly checks identify developing issues:

  • Visual inspection of exterior chimney condition

  • Check damper operation and sealing

  • Monitor for unusual odors or smoke patterns

  • Verify proper operation of chimney cap and screen

Annual Professional Services

Professional maintenance addresses complex safety concerns:

  • Complete chimney cleaning and inspection

  • Flue liner assessment and repair

  • Structural integrity evaluation

  • Carbon monoxide testing and safety verification

Emergency Response Procedures

When chimney overheating issues escalate to emergency situations, quick action prevents catastrophic damage and protects lives. Understanding proper emergency procedures ensures effective response during critical moments.

Immediate Actions for Overheating

Take these steps when detecting dangerous overheating:

  • Immediately stop adding fuel to the fire

  • Close air vents to reduce oxygen supply

  • Call fire department if flames are visible in the chimney

  • Evacuate the building and wait for professional assistance

Post-Emergency Assessment

After any overheating incident, thorough evaluation is essential:

  • Schedule immediate professional inspection

  • Document damage for insurance purposes

  • Avoid using the chimney until cleared by professionals

  • Address any smoke damage to interior spaces

Cost Considerations for Safety Measures

Investing in proper fireplace safety and maintenance prevents costly emergency repairs and protects your property value. Understanding typical costs helps homeowners budget for essential safety measures.

Routine Maintenance Costs

Regular maintenance represents the most cost-effective safety investment:

  • Annual cleaning and inspection: INR 3,000-8,000

  • Minor repairs and adjustments: INR 2,000-5,000

  • Chimney cap installation: INR 4,000-12,000

  • Creosote removal services: INR 2,500-6,000

Major Repair Investments

Addressing serious issues requires significant investment but prevents catastrophic loss:

  • Flue liner replacement: INR 25,000-75,000

  • Structural chimney repairs: INR 15,000-50,000

  • Complete chimney rebuilding: INR 1,00,000-3,00,000

  • Fire damage restoration: INR 50,000-2,00,000+

Frequently Asked Questions

Can a chimney overheat?

Yes, chimneys can overheat due to excessive creosote buildup, blocked flues, or improper operation. Severe creosote appears as a dark, tar-like substance that combusts at high temperatures, potentially overheating your entire chimney system and creating fire hazards.

How often should I inspect my chimney for overheating issues?

Conduct visual inspections monthly during heating season and schedule professional chimney inspection annually. If you notice any warning signs like unusual odors, discoloration, or smoke damage, inspect immediately and contact professionals.

What's the difference between chimney overheating and a chimney fire?

Chimney overheating refers to excessive heat buildup that can damage the structure, while a chimney fire involves actual combustion of creosote deposits. Overheating often precedes fires and should be addressed immediately to prevent escalation.

How can I prevent carbon monoxide poisoning from an overheating chimney?

Install carbon monoxide detectors on every level of your home, ensure proper ventilation, and never ignore signs of poor draft or flue blockage. If detectors alarm or you experience symptoms like headaches or dizziness, evacuate immediately and call professionals.

What should I do if my wood stove is overheating?

Immediately reduce air supply by closing vents, stop adding fuel, and monitor the situation closely. If temperatures don't decrease or you see flames in the chimney, evacuate and call the fire department. Never use water on an overheated wood stove as it can cause dangerous steam and thermal shock.

How much does professional chimney maintenance cost in India?

Professional chimney maintenance typically costs INR 3,000-8,000 for annual cleaning and inspection. More extensive services like creosote removal or minor repairs range from INR 2,000-6,000, while major structural work can cost INR 25,000-75,000 depending on the scope.
